What Are the Biological Factors?

Biologically, a woman’s fertility peaks in her 20s and starts declining from her mid-30s. So, from a biological standpoint, the ideal age for women to start a family is in their 20s.

This is because the chances of conceiving naturally are higher, and the risks of complications during pregnancy and childbirth are lower. However, there are several other factors to consider when deciding on the best age to start a family.

What Are the Social Factors?

Social factors such as education, career, and financial stability can also influence when a woman decides to start a family.

Many women prioritize their education or career in their 20s and early 30s, and may not feel ready to start a family until they have achieved certain milestones in their professional lives. Additionally, having a stable financial situation can provide some sense of security and stability when having a family.

What Are the Risks of Waiting?

While waiting until later in life to start a family can have certain benefits, there are also risks associated with waiting too long. As mentioned earlier, fertility decreases with age, making it more difficult to conceive naturally.

Women who wait until their mid-30s or later to start a family are at a higher risk of complications during pregnancy and childbirth, including gestational diabetes, preeclampsia, and premature birth.

What Are the Benefits of Waiting?

Waiting to start a family can also have certain benefits.

Women who prioritize their education and career in their 20s and 30s may have a higher earning potential and a more stable financial situation, which can provide a better quality of life for their future children. Additionally, waiting to start a family can give women the opportunity to travel, pursue hobbies, and develop other interests that may be more difficult to pursue once they have children.

What Is the Best Age to Start a Family?

So, what is the best age to start a family? The truth is that there is no one-size-fits-all answer to this question.

The ideal age to start a family will depend on individual circumstances, including your personal goals, financial situation, and overall health. It is important to consider all of these factors when deciding on the best age to start a family.

What Are the Options for Women Who Want to Start a Family Later in Life?

For women who choose to wait until later in life to start a family, there are several options available to help overcome the challenges of fertility and pregnancy complications.

These options include fertility treatments such as in vitro fertilization (IVF), egg freezing, and surrogacy. It is important to discuss these options with a healthcare professional to determine the best course of action.
